Output 26e5a9a6d721b33de2920a2fd07b34ba5d37eb5df1ccffad488879e065ca9cda:0

value
1491194
script pubkey
OP_0 OP_PUSHBYTES_20 d770f0abd388bf82c58843f25f60d7b1b7f79753
address
bc1q6ac0p27n3zlc93vgg0e97cxhkxml096n9rsprw
transaction
26e5a9a6d721b33de2920a2fd07b34ba5d37eb5df1ccffad488879e065ca9cda
confirmations
173328
spent
true